29 November 2007; Dessie Farrell, GPA Chief Executive, with Kieran McGeeney, GPA Secretary, at a press conference to announce the agreement between the Minister for Arts, Sport and Tourism and the Irish Sports Council, GAA and GPA to recognise the contribution of Senior Inter-County Players and additional costs associated with enhancing team performance. The decision taken by the Minister for Arts, Sport and Tourism, Mr Seamus Brennan TD is to provide the sum of 3.5m euro to fund an Annual Team Performance Scheme and an Annual Support Scheme for inter-county GAA players.
